Cost of lead cames

The cost of lead comes for stained glass repair may vary dependent on a variety of aspects. This includes the kind of damage, the type of glass, and the amount of cameing needed. An expert in stained glass can give you a precise estimate of the cost of repairs.

Lead cames are a critical element of stained glass. They form the framework for many windows. They are also susceptible to wear and tear. Therefore, they will weaken over time, leading to failure.

Traditionally, cames were made by pouring molten lead into moulds. The moulds were then cut to the desired size. Round profile leads have been the norm since the 1920s. This makes them easier to use. It also provides a wide range of lead sizes and shapes.

In the early period of American stained glass, most of the cames employed were flat. They were 3/16 inches to 1/4 inches in width. To make sure that lead was not used for ammunition, the economy made lead thinner during WWII.

The lead of the late 1800s was much more pure. While it was not as strong than the current "restoration quality" lead, it contained more elements that helped to harden the material.

This less durable lead has been used in a variety of generations of windows. As time passes, the lead's quality decreases due to the process of oxidation. This causes a dark, bluish-gray patina. If this occurs, the came needs to be replaced.

One method of determining the age of a came is to look at its ID. An older sample has an oxide layer that is well-developed, which is 0.008 inches thick. The presence of remnants of caulking on its came ID is another indicator of its age.

Maintenance of stained glass windows repair

If properly maintained stained glass windows can last for many centuries. Regular cleaning and maintenance is vital to keep stained-glass windows in top condition.

One method of preserving stained glass is to use protective glazing. This kind of glass prevents moisture and air from entering the building, which helps stop the process of deterioration. However the protective coverings must be properly ventilated. They could cause more issues than they resolve.

Additionally it is essential to protect stained glass whenever it is exposed to other kinds of work. For instance, it is essential to keep the building's interior and exterior free of chemical cleaners. Cleaning can cause damage to the glass if you don't.

Maintaining the window is easy if you remember that removing the leaded glass is cheaper than replacing the entire glass. It is a good idea to have large projects to be handled by a consultant.

For any repair work it is best to consult a specialist who has experience in the preservation of stained glass. Request references and a full quote in the event that you hire an expert. You should also look up the references of other projects in the same building.

Protective glazing isn't a replacement for proper care. However, it can slow the degradation of stained glass.

It is possible to increase the strength of a panel assembly made of leaded by adding reinforcements, such as galvanized steel bar or copper wire. This will give structural strength that is able to withstand the forces of gravity or wind.
